Beyond Termination:  A Spouse's Story of Pain and Healing

Myra Marshall with Dan McGee, Ph.D. and Jennifer Bryon Owen
Broadman Press, 1990

Myra Marshall with help from her husband and children shares her personal story.  The book also includes stories of others who have survived forced terminations, and observations by her brother, a former pastor and medical psychotherapist, of her experiences of forced termination and the healing process which followed.

In this framework of multiple perspectives, her vulnerability and her honesty hold out hope for others who are experiencing similar terminations.  The book also speaks of churches which seek to avoid or heal from the wounds of such trauma.

She states her purpose clearly, "We are seeking to help both churches and ministers understand the effects of termination on the minister and his or her family," (p. 23).  Mrs. Marshall has not shrunk from revealing the depths of pain nor the triumphs of growth through suffering.

I highly recommend this as an honest and thorough examination of forced termination.  You may weep and you may get angry.  Both are appropriate reactions.  The illumination provided by this wise book is a gift for all who are struggling with the phenomenon of forced termination.
